Caricature - [Batavian Revolt - Democracy - Orangists - William V of Orange - Court jesters] Wy ryden naar St. Omer. Northern Nederlands, (1787). Plate size: ca. 25 x 18.5 cm; Sheet size: ca. 32 x 26 cm. Engraved political caricature depicting the defeated Patriots as 3 court fools riding on donkeys to St. Omer in France.
Fine and rare engraved political print, a caricature by the Orangists on the flight of the defeated Dutch Patriots to St. Omer, France in 1787. The Patriots, a revolutionary democratic movement, also in favour of the American Independence, challenged from about 1780 more and more the authority of the Stadtholder William V of Orange. In 1785 Wiliam even had to move his court to the Southern Netherlands. But his more energetic wife, sister of Frederik Wilhelm II of Prussia, tried to force the issue by travelling to The Hague. After she was stopped at Goejanverwellesluis by the Patriots of Gouda, she made her brother raid the Northern Netherlands. It marked the end of the Dutch Patriot movement and the return of William V to The Hague. The Patriots had to wait until the French Revolution for democratic reforms.

1683 John Jewel Apology Church England Elizabeth Catholic v Protestant AnglicanJohn Jewel was a 16th-century English bishop known for his support of Elizabeth I and the Church of England. Shortly after the Protestant Reformation in mainland Europe, Jewel wrote an 'Apology of the Church of England' – a work of political significance which describes doctrine and faith practices of the Church of England under Elizabeth I. This book served as a necessary defense against Catholic Romanists' claims of heresy and provided a clear justification of Anglican and Protestant faiths.

De Wervelwind. Maandblad voor Vrijheid, Waarheid en Recht."Whirlwind, Monthly Magazine for Freedom, Truth and Justice."No.1, April 1942, First Year Edition. Text in the Dutch language; pp 31. Very rare.Flyer for the Netherlands during World War II, spread by dropping by the Royal Air Force on behalf of the Dutch people and Dutch Resistance during the occupation of Nazi Germany.The magazine is very small for passing in secret from one to another.Photo's of Queen Wilhelmina, Royal Dutch Family, resistance in other European countries, Raid on St. Nazaire by British Forces, German failure in Russia, etc.Shipping with track and trace.Inventory number: RAF.01.01.100.(1)Also available :The Diary of Anne Frank.
